108 idols, 64 lion statues, 1,000 pillars: How West Bengal is building a massive year-round landmark for Durga Puja, a UNESCO cultural heritage · indianexpress.com

West Bengal is building a huge new place for Durga Puja, which is a big festival.

This place will be open all year and not just during the festival.

It will have lots of statues of gods and goddesses, including 108 idols and 64 lion statues.

There will be a big central area where 1,000 people can sit for prayers and events.

The building will be very tall, about 54 meters high, and will have over 1,000 pillars.

It will also have a museum about the history of Durga Puja.

The government is paying for it, and it should be finished by late 2027.

Key facts

Location
New Town, Kolkata, West Bengal
Size
17.28 acres
Idols
108 idols of various deities
Lion Statues
64 lion statues
Pillars
1,008 pillars
Height of Garbha Griha
54 metres (177 feet)
Cost
Rs 261.99 crore
Expected Completion
Late 2027
